Essential Malware Removal: Secure Your Digital Life

Navigating the digital world can be treacherous without understanding the threats lurking within. Malicious Software can wreak havoc on your devices and compromise your sensitive data. Fortunately, there are proactive steps you can take to mitigate these risks and protect your valuable information.

  • First and foremost, ensure your operating system and applications are always up-to-date. These updates often include patches that address known vulnerabilities exploited by malware.
  • Be cautious about opening email attachments or clicking on links from unknown senders. They could lead to malicious websites or download harmful files.
  • Utilize a reputable antivirus program and keep it actively scanning your devices for threats. This will help detect and remove any malware that may have already infiltrated your system.
  • Regularly back up your important data to an external hard drive or cloud storage service. In the event of a malware infection, this backup can serve as a crucial safeguard for your files.

Remember, staying informed and practicing safe computing habits are essential for safeguarding your data in today's digital landscape.
